Bad News: RIP Jim Johnson. A 22-year assistant in the NFL, including 10 seasons as defensive coordinator for the Eagles, died yesterday after a sixth-month battle with spinal cancer. He was 68. From 2000-08, his Eagles’ defense ranked second in the NFL with 390 sacks. In his 10-year tenure, the Eagles had 26 Pro Bowl selections on the defensive side of the ball.
